The NFL has a new 5-year deal in place with Nike for team uniforms, and the results have officially been released. After much speculation on what the new deal would bring, images were released in New York today.

The biggest revisions to the uniforms are slight design tweaks and the material jerseys are made of. From a distance, the average person might not see much of a difference for most team uniforms, including those for the Vikings. The only major notable revision is for the Seattle Seahawks, who got the neon treatment - getting neon green trim on their jerseys to replace the darker green blue that existed previously.
